The model proposes. Policy bounds. You own signatures. Multi-profile desks route each request to the right surface. Vaults, perps, bridges, and protocol scaffolds, not just swaps. Empty allowlists refuse everything until you configure them.
Max value, chain, venue, destinations, and TTL. Outside the grant = hard refuse, not an agent with a free wallet.
hl, poly, evm-swap, evm-bridge, btc, sol. Each decodes its own envelope, proves every value-moving field, and refuses while its allowlists are empty.
Prepared actions ship as stamped, hash-bound envelopes. Money claims end in tx hash, receipt status, balance delta, and allowance state. No “looks filled.”
minOut, impact, spender, and decoded calldata before approval. Export unsigned artifacts for hardware wallets.
Destination allowlists stop silent router drift. New contracts stay blocked until you add them.
A fresh install signs nothing. Every lane refuses while its allowlists are empty, so nothing moves until you set the bounds.

Every chain reads live. Route means Oracle can also price and prepare a swap there; read only means the venue registry is still empty, so routing fail-closes rather than guessing a router. Any EVM chain can be registered with a chain id and an RPC.
Asset info, order + bracket prepare, cancel, leverage and isolated-margin updates. Tick and lot sizing enforced to 5 sig figs.
Spot meta, mids, L2 book, candles, market and coin datapoints, leaderboards.
Validator summaries, delegations, rewards and history. Stake deposit, withdraw and delegate prepare with a 7-day unstaking queue.
HIP-4 outcome listing plus order and cancel prepare.
Clearinghouse state, open orders, user fills, positions.
